Abstract
In the presence of a catalytic amount of tetrakis(triphenylphosphine)palladium(0), the 1,1,2,2-tetraethoxydimethyldisilane reacts with various functional bromoarenes giving the corresponding aryldiethoxymethylsilanes in good yields. The creation of SiC Ar bonds involving a polyalcoxydisilane as the silylating reagent is here reported for the first time.
